2 citations on file for this inspection.

1926.451 G01

Serious Gravity 10 1 instance 2 exposed

Initial $3978.00 · Current $2700.00 Reduced
29 CFR 1926.451(g)(1): Employees on scaffolds more than 10 feet (3.1 m) above a lower level were not protected from falling to that lower level by fall protection established in paragraphs (g)(1)(i)-(vii) of this section:  a)  At 67 Parks Edge, Lot 13 The Village Tannin, Orange Beach, Alabama:  On or about March 26, 2019 and at times prior; the employer allowed his employees to work from a ladder jack scaffold without fall protection exposing his employees to a fall hazard of up to 18.5 feet to the ground below.

29 CFR 1926.454(a): The employer did not have each employee who performed work while on a scaffold trained by a person qualified in the subject matter to recognize the hazards associated with the type of scaffold being used and to understand the procedures to control or minimize those hazards:  a)  At 67 Parks Edge, Lot 13 The Village Tannin, Orange Beach, Alabama:  On or about March 26, 2019 and at times prior; the employer allowed his employees to perform painting activities from a ladder  jack scaffold without first ensuring his employees were trained on the hazards associated with scaffolds to include but not limited to setting up and maintaining fall protection systems exposing his employees to a fall hazard of up to 18.5 feet to the ground below.
